In-vitro fertilization (IVF) is a complex fertility method that involves fertilizing an egg with sperm outside the body, in a laboratory setting. This zygote is then transferred to the woman's uterus with the hope of achieving a pregnancy. IVF can be a life-changing option for individuals and couples struggling with difficulty conceiving.
There are many elements that contribute to the success of IVF, including age, medical history, and lifestyle choices. It's important to speak with a fertility specialist to assess if IVF is right for you and to discuss the possible risks and benefits.

Success Rates and Considerations for IVF Fertility Treatment
In-Vitro Fertilization (IVF) has emerged as a promising tool for individuals and here couples struggling fertility challenges. While IVF offers considerable success rates, it's crucial to understand the factors determining outcomes and the considerations involved in this process. Numerous variables come into play, including age, fundamental medical conditions, ovarian capacity, and the individualized treatment protocol utilized. Success rates differ depending on these factors, with younger patients and those with good reproductive health often exhibiting improved success probabilities. It's important to discuss with a qualified fertility specialist who can evaluate your specific situation, provide customized treatment recommendations, and offer realistic expectations regarding potential outcomes.
A comprehensive IVF journey often involves several stages, each necessitating careful monitoring and management. Throughout this process, it's essential to preserve open interaction with your medical team, resolve any concerns or questions promptly, and comply their guidance diligently. Success in IVF entails a combination of medical expertise, patient participation, and a healthy dose of hope and resilience.
Beginning IVF
Undergoing IVF is a significant choice, demanding careful preparation for the best possible outcomes.
First and foremost, you'll need to speak with a reproductive specialist. They'll conduct a thorough review of your medical history and discuss the IVF process in detail. This includes understanding the medications involved, potential challenges, and outcomes.
It's important to undertake a healthy lifestyle leading up to IVF. Aim for a nutritious diet, engage in regular exercise, and manage stress through techniques like yoga.
You may also be recommended to take part in certain tests to guarantee optimal reproductive health. These could include bloodwork, ultrasounds, and hormone level checks.
Your specialist will guide you through the specific steps tailored to your individual situation. Be sure to ask any questions you have throughout this process to feel comfortable and well-informed.
